One of the specimens (NCSM 41116) represents a new size record for the species (25.5 cm SL, 30.5 cm TL), and another (GMBL 02788) represents a southerly range extension (31°23.94'N). All specimens observed exhibited similar behaviors of sitting on the bottom on top of dense beds of dead coral (Lophelia pertusa) (Ref. 58471).
